Heads up for whoever inherits this: the Lanewick schema-migration runner (the one doing our zero-downtime dual-write dance on the orders tables) stopped cold last night because its service credentials expired. Migrations were designed to pause safely, so nothing's corrupted, but the backfill is stalled at phase two. We rotated the credential and verified the expand/contract steps resume cleanly. Please don't let this one lapse again — set a calendar nudge. The fresh key for the migrator service is below.

API key for tagef-fafop: vxb2-ta

☐ Import wizard key check — Quillbasin CSV tools. Plugin authors: verify the wizard's signing key matches the ceremony manifest before publishing column-mapper plugins. Mismatched signatures are rejected at upload. Do not regenerate keys locally. When the steward calls your slot, unlock the escrow bundle with the phrase that follows.

unlock words, haduf-hadup: holox-rusion-julwyn-drudor-praok-pelius-druion-casael-lamath-pelix

## Rate-Parity Checker: On-Call Notes

The Farlowe parity checker compares nightly room rates across our Quillmere partner feeds. If the comparison job stalls, restart the worker pool and re-run the last window. Manual re-runs require authenticating against the internal Quillmere ingest service; use the key below.

API key for fahif-bahop: vxb23-B1zKyQaAnaG4Gma9WuizPfB

Ticket: Framelark snapshot uploads failing with 401

The credential used by the Framelark snapshot-testing service for UI components expired on schedule, and nobody updated the CI secret. All baseline comparisons now fail at the upload step, so visual diffs are silently skipped. For future maintainers: expiry is 90 days, and rotation must be reflected in both the pipeline config and the local dev overrides. The replacement key is below.

gateway credential: kto23_dolYgAScEh2TaPOlStqOl98